The Greater Manchester borough with four of the 10 worst train stations in the country

The rail service from Bolton’s smaller towns has been branded a ‘disgrace’ after four of them were included in the top 10 worst train stations in the UK. Over the four weeks leading to May 29, Kearsley train station had a staggering 81 per cent of services delayed or cancelled.

The 'avalanche' of bank closures across Greater Manchester and the UK - www.manchestereveningnews.co.uk - Britain - Scotland - Manchester
manchestereveningnews.co.uk
27.05.2024 / 06:53

The 'avalanche' of bank closures across Greater Manchester and the UK

Nearly 1,500 banks in the UK have either shut their doors or announced their intention to close since February 2022. That's nearly two a DAY across the country.
